Transaction ffb592731bef140eff6e84882c92271d8bfe023decfc2f9f84de114e5c94ab95
1 Input
1 Output
-
ffb592731bef140eff6e84882c92271d8bfe023decfc2f9f84de114e5c94ab95:0
- value
- 299859003
- script pubkey
- OP_0 OP_PUSHBYTES_20 3a948d0198c801a4b75121a86c1beb6c4a7b829c
- address
- bc1q822g6qvceqq6fd63yx5xcxltd398hq5u08vp3f